Abstract

Four undescribed secocycloartane monoglycosides (1–4) were isolated from an ethanolic extract of the dry flowers of Cordia lutea Lam. Their structural assignment is based on NMR and MS analysis. Their stereochemistry is confirmed by molecular modelling studies using DFT-NMR calculations done for compound 3. In vitro antibacterial activity of the four compounds was moderate on Helicobacter pylori (MIC = 15.6 μg/mL), and much weaker on Staphylococcus aureus, Pseudomonas aeruginosa or Escherichia coli (MIC >125 μg/mL). Toxicity evaluated against RAW 264.7 cells was weak (IC50 values ranging from 24 to 41 μM i.e. 15 to 24 μg/mL), but in the same range as anti-Helicobacter activity.
